Could Success on ‘Fox News Sunday’ Determine 2016 Candidate?

By Brian Flood 

WallaceThe Washington Post has listed “Five things to watch as the 2016 campaigns develop” and a prominent TV newser makes the cut.

Money, endorsements, staff and polling are the first four listed as things that can determine the viability of each of the campaigns. The fifth? Live TV appearances. A successful interview with “Fox News Sunday” host Chris Wallace to be more specific.

The Post says, “Getting through a successful appearance with Wallace may be as important as any other challenge a [Republican] candidate will face before the start of the primaries.”
